Active Listening: With a 30% share, active listening is the most sought-after skill in crisis negotiation. Effective communication is vital for any negotiator, and being able to truly listen to the other party's concerns is essential for reaching a successful resolution. Problem-Solving: Coming in second, problem-solving accounts for 25% of the demand in crisis negotiation. Negotiators must be able to analyze complex situations and develop creative solutions that benefit all parties involved. Critical Thinking: Making up 20% of the demand, critical thinking enables negotiators to evaluate information objectively and make well-informed decisions. Empathy: At 15%, empathy is an essential skill for any negotiator. Understanding the other party's emotions and perspectives can help build trust and facilitate a more productive conversation. Assertiveness: Finally, assertiveness accounts for 10% of the demand in crisis negotiation. Negotiators must be able to express their own needs and desires while still respecting the other party's viewpoint.
